Report Overview

Carbon-carbon composites are high-performance composite materials consisting of carbon fibers and a carbon matrix. They exhibit excellent mechanical strength and thermal stability at high temperatures, and have high heat resistance and thermal shock resistance, so they are widely used in the aerospace field. This material is often used to manufacture brake discs for aerospace vehicles, missile nose cones, rocket nozzles, and other structural parts that need to withstand extreme temperatures. Carbon/carbon composites are formed by weaving or laying carbon fibers together, and then carbonizing them at high temperatures to obtain high-strength, lightweight composites.

The global Carbon-carbon Composites for Aerospace market size was estimated at USD 1350 million in 2023 and is projected to reach USD 1872.16 million by 2032, exhibiting a CAGR of 3.70% during the forecast period.

North America Carbon-carbon Composites for Aerospace market size was estimated at USD 374.44 million in 2023, at a CAGR of 3.17% during the forecast period of 2024 through 2032.
